I think I have lost my fusion drive

I have recently upgraded to El capitan, it crashed during upgrade and I had to erase the hard drive and start again from time machine back up

My drive now looks like this?

and is running very slow.

Where exactly did you delete the contents? (Disk Utility in the installer?)

We really need to see output from diskutil list and diskutil cs list in Terminal, but it looks like you might have partitioned the drives again while erasing. In this case the system will be slower because the OS is running from the platter HD, not the SSD.

What you need to do is start Recovery Mode, go into Terminal under the Utilities menu and run a few commands to recreate the Fusion drive. (Many DIY instructions on the net)

After that is complete you can restore using Time Machine.
